PURPOSE: To show the basic static and dynamic conditions of a cart on an incline.
DESCRIPTION: A low friction dynamic cart is balanced with a pulley and weights in static equilibrium on an incline plane. Subtract a mass from the weight hanger to force the cart down the incline. Reset the cart in back to the original equilibrium. Add a mass to the weight hanger to force the cart up the incline.
To show more friction flip the cart over so that it is off the wheels and slides on the block. Raise the incline to a high angle to show force the cart to slide down the incline.
EQUIPMENT: Dynamic cart, track, pulley with mass hanger, three 20 gram masses, large classroom protractor.
SETUP NOTES: Determine the angle to balance the cart in static equilibrium with
the two 20 gram masses. Subtract one 20 gram mass to roll downhill. Add one 20
gram mass to roll uphill.
